
<node> 그래프에서 (표지가 붙는 지점일 수도 있는) 노드를 부호화한다. [19.1 Graphs and Digraphs]
모듈nets — Graphs, Networks, and Trees
속성att.global (@xml:id, @n, @xml:lang, @xml:base, @xml:space) (att.global.rendition (@rend, @style, @rendition)) (att.global.linking (@corresp, @synch, @sameAs, @copyOf, @next, @prev, @exclude, @select)) (att.global.analytic (@ana)) (att.global.facs (@facs)) (att.global.change (@change)) (att.global.responsibility (@cert, @resp)) (att.global.source (@source)) att.typed (type, @subtype)
type노드의 유형을 제공한다.
Derived fromatt.typed
상태 수의적
자료 유형 teidata.enumerated
 <node xml:id="gnex11adjTo="#gnex12"

 <node xml:id="gnex12adjFrom="#gnex11"

 <node xml:id="gnex13adjFrom="#gnex12"

value노드의 값을 제공하며, 이 값은 자질 구조 또는 다른 분석적 요소이다.
상태 수의적
자료 유형 teidata.pointer
adjTo(로 인접한) 현 노드에 인접한 노드의 확인소를 제시한다.
상태 수의적
자료 유형 1–∞ 출현 teidata.pointer 공백문자로 분리됨
 <node xml:id="gnex21adjTo="#gnex22"

 <node xml:id="gnex22adjTo="#gnex23">
 <node xml:id="gnex23type="final">
adjFrom(~로부터 인접한) 현 노드로부터 인접한 노드의 확인소를 제시한다.
상태 수의적
자료 유형 1–∞ 출현 teidata.pointer 공백문자로 분리됨
 <node xml:id="gnex31type="initial">
 <node xml:id="gnex32adjFrom="#gnex31">
 <node xml:id="gnex33adjFrom="#gnex32"

adj(인접한) 현 노드로 인접한 그리고 현 노드로부터 인접한 노드의 확인소를 제시한다.
상태 수의적
자료 유형 1–∞ 출현 teidata.pointer 공백문자로 분리됨
 <node xml:id="gnex41"
  adj="#gnex42 #gnex43type="initial">

 <node xml:id="gnex42"
  adj="#gnex41 #gnex43">

 <node xml:id="gnex43"
  adj="#gnex42 #gnex41type="final">

inDegree주어진 노드로부터 인접한 노드의 수인, 노드의 정도를 제시한다.
상태 수의적
자료 유형 teidata.count
 <node xml:id="gnex51adjTo="#gnex52"

 <node xml:id="gnex52adjFrom="#gnex51"

 <node xml:id="gnex53adjFrom="#gnex52"

outDegree주어진 노드에 인접한 노드의 수인, 노드의 정도를 제시한다.
상태 수의적
자료 유형 teidata.count
 <node xml:id="gnex61adjTo="#gnex62"

 <node xml:id="gnex62adjFrom="#gnex61"

 <node xml:id="gnex63adjFrom="#gnex62"

degree노드와 함께 나타나는 호의 수인, 노드의 정도를 제시한다.
상태 수의적
자료 유형 teidata.count
 <node xml:id="gnex71adjTo="#gnex72"

 <node xml:id="gnex72adjFrom="#gnex71"

 <node xml:id="gnex73adjFrom="#gnex72"

에 의해 포함된
nets: graph
포함할 수 있다
core: label

Zero, one, or two children label elements may be present. The first occurence of label provides a label for the arc; the second provides a second label for the arc, and should be used if a transducer is being encoded whose actions are associated with nodes rather than with arcs.

<node xml:id="t6type="finalinDegree="2"

Content model
 <sequence minOccurs="0">
  <elementRef key="label"/>
  <elementRef key="labelminOccurs="0"/>
<rng:element name="node">
 <rng:ref name="att.global.attributes"/>
 <rng:ref name="att.global.rendition.attributes"/>
 <rng:ref name="att.global.linking.attributes"/>
 <rng:ref name="att.global.analytic.attributes"/>
 <rng:ref name="att.global.facs.attributes"/>
 <rng:ref name="att.global.change.attributes"/>
 <rng:ref name="att.global.responsibility.attributes"/>
 <rng:ref name="att.global.source.attributes"/>
 <rng:ref name="att.typed.attribute.subtype"/>
  <rng:attribute name="type">
   <rng:ref name="teidata.enumerated"/>
  <rng:attribute name="value">
   <rng:ref name="teidata.pointer"/>
  <rng:attribute name="adjTo">
     <rng:ref name="teidata.pointer"/>
  <rng:attribute name="adjFrom">
     <rng:ref name="teidata.pointer"/>
  <rng:attribute name="adj">
     <rng:ref name="teidata.pointer"/>
  <rng:attribute name="inDegree">
   <rng:ref name="teidata.count"/>
  <rng:attribute name="outDegree">
   <rng:ref name="teidata.count"/>
  <rng:attribute name="degree">
   <rng:ref name="teidata.count"/>
   <rng:ref name="label"/>
    <rng:ref name="label"/>
element node
   attribute type { teidata.enumerated }?,
   attribute value { teidata.pointer }?,
   attribute adjTo { list { teidata.pointer+ } }?,
   attribute adjFrom { list { teidata.pointer+ } }?,
   attribute adj { list { teidata.pointer+ } }?,
   attribute inDegree { teidata.count }?,
   attribute outDegree { teidata.count }?,
   attribute degree { teidata.count }?,
   ( label, label? )?